New Babies
A lot has been going on over the summer. We have bred for juniors for our livestock show and the babies are just now being born. Skye had four kits (1 blue, 1 broken black, 1 broken blue, and a lilac) last week with 2 surviving. The lilac and broken blue have survived. Zebra just had her babies today. We were hoping for 4, but were shocked to get 6! All look to be healthy and nice size. She has 2 black, 1 blue, 2 broken black, & 1 broken blue. Our last litter due is from Bell. She is due September 3. She is very moody right now. Waiting for her to have her babies so she will go back to her sweet self.

BUILDING OUR RABBITRY
We have had several litters and have a few more we are expecting within the next week or two. They are gorgeous! We are so excited!
More pictures are soon to come. Terry manages our does and the birthing and babies. I manage the bucks to breed from. We have genetics for blacks, chocolates, blues and broken in the same colors; all are pedigreed. Our last litter of kits produced some beautiful babies both bucks and does.
Our kids are excited to show a few of our new kits as Junior Fancy Polish in the NCJLS winter of 2015.
We also provide pedigreed pet Polish at a reduced rate. These are the babies that are sweet and lovable but not quite show quality. Polish rabbits are small. They don't get any larger than a full grown guinea pig. AND, they litter train. They are easy to maintain. My children each have a polish as a pet and adore cuddling with their sweet little bunnies.
